Anti-Lock Braking System (ABS)

Anti-Lock Braking System (ABS)

WARNING: Always maintain an appropriate stopping distance from the vehicle in front. ABS cannot overcome the physical limitations of trying to stop the vehicle in too short a distance, cornering at too high a speed, or the danger of hydroplaning, i.e., where a layer of water prevents adequate contact between the tires and the road surface.

WARNING: The braking distance on road surfaces that are wet, slippery or loose is always increased; even for vehicles equipped with ABS.

WARNING: Always drive with due care and attention to your surroundings and road conditions. ABS does not correct driver errors.

Your vehicle is equipped with an Anti-lock Braking System (ABS) that prevents the wheels from locking during hard braking or when braking on roads with reduced grip.

During braking, the ABS monitors the speed of each wheel and varies the brake fluid pressure at each wheel to prevent the wheels from locking. This system helps maintain steering ability during maximum brake application.

When ABS activates, you may experience the following conditions:

  • Pulsations in the brake pedal

  • A slight drop of the brake pedal

  • Clicking or grinding noises

  • ABS warning indicator flickering on and off as the system activates

These conditions demonstrate that ABS is operating and are not a cause for concern. Maintain a firm and steady pressure on the brake pedal while experiencing the pulsation.

Emergency braking

WARNING: Do not pump the brake pedal. This interrupts the operation of the ABS system and increases your stopping distance, which could lead to a collision.

In an emergency, fully press the brake pedal even when the road surface is slippery.

ABS warning indicator

The ABS indicator (telltale) displays on the Driver Display, along with a notification message.

  • If the indicator is flashing, a fault has been detected.

  • If the indicator remains displayed, the system has been disabled.

Contact Fisker via the Fisker App as soon as possible to have the fault repaired.

CAUTION: If the ABS warning indicator is displayed, the foot-operated braking system remains operational. Be aware that braking distances may increase and wheels may lock under heavy braking.
